# Tactors SDK
Tactors is a typed, builder-first actor SDK for Go. You describe state, handlers, activities, and
runtime knobs in one fluent API and receive a deterministic actor description that every runtime can
consume—no code generation or `interface{}` plumbing. We still touch Go’s `%T` formatting to label
types, but handler routing stays strongly typed.
## What you get
- Typed actor builders: fix state with `actors.NewStateful`, get typed commands/queries/activities
via helper embeds, and build once for every runtime consumer.
- Declarative knobs: retries, timeouts, caches, queue overrides, snapshots, and validators live on
the builder so intent is obvious.
- Temporal-first runtime: one `actors.Description` powers worker registration, Ask/Query plumbing,
and the deterministic testsuite—no alt runtimes or codegen.
- Ops hooks: spans/metrics around commands and cross-actor calls; rotation/versioning via
`WithSnapshot` and `actors.Patch`.

## Testkit quick use
- `testkit.ActorTemporalScenario` runs actors against Temporal’s testsuite. Stub activities inline
with `WhenActivity(...)`; it infers names from typed signatures or accepts explicit names.
- Inspect merged activity options with `ExpectActivityOptions` helpers before execution.
## Temporal runtime at a glance
- `runtime` registers workflows/activities from an actor description and wires Ask/Query/Spawn to
Temporal signals, queries, and child workflows.
- `runtime.NewWorkerSet` reuses workers per queue and rotates histories automatically when
`WithSnapshot` or `GetContinueAsNewSuggested()` triggers.
- Queue defaults match the actor kind (`-workflow` / `-activity`), and workers
auto-disable the unused role so activity-only or workflow-only actors do not need extra flags.
If you explicitly point both roles at the same queue and register both, one worker serves both.
- Activity calls get safe defaults: a StartToClose of 30s and ScheduleToClose of 2m are applied if
you don’t set either. Override with `actors.WithActivityStartToClose` or
`actors.WithActivityScheduleToClose` per-call or via `WithActivityDefaults`.
## Repository guide
- `actors/` – builder, typed helpers, and shared primitives.
- `runtime/` – Temporal runner plus typed client utilities.
- `testkit/` – deterministic harnesses (Temporal scenario and testing helpers).
- `observability/` – pluggable tracing/metrics hooks; `internal/` – supporting packages as we flesh
out tooling.
- Samples now live in the sibling repo: https://github.com/tactors/samples.
## Testing
Run the full suite (unit tests and Temporal testsuite scenarios) with:
```bash
GOCACHE=$(pwd)/.gocache go test ./...
```
No external Temporal server is required—the testsuite handles registration, fake time, and cleanup.
